#nullable enable
using System;
using System.Collections.Generic;
using System.Threading;
using System.Threading.Tasks;
using System.Threading.Channels;
using FluentAssertions;
using Io.Cucumber.Messages.Types;
using Moq;
using Reqnroll.Formatters;
using Reqnroll.Formatters.Configuration;
using Reqnroll.Formatters.PubSub;
using Reqnroll.Formatters.RuntimeSupport;
using Xunit;
namespace Reqnroll.RuntimeTests.Formatters;
public class FormatterBaseTests
{
private class TestFormatter : FormatterBase
{
public bool LaunchInnerCalled = false;
public IDictionary<string, object> LaunchInnerConfig = null!;
public Action<bool> LaunchInnerCallback = null!;
public bool ConsumeAndFormatMessagesCalled = false;
public CancellationToken? ConsumedToken;
public List<Envelope> ConsumedMessages = new();
public bool ReportInitializedCalled = false;
public bool CloseAsyncCalled = false;
public bool CompleteWriterOnLaunchInner = false;
protected override TimeSpan DisposeTimeout => TimeSpan.FromMilliseconds(100);
protected override TimeSpan DisposeCancellationTimeout => TimeSpan.FromMilliseconds(100);
public TestFormatter(IFormattersConfigurationProvider config, IFormatterLog logger, string name)
: base(config, logger, name) { }
public override void LaunchInner(IDictionary<string, object> formatterConfig, Action<bool> onAfterInitialization)
{
LaunchInnerCalled = true;
LaunchInnerConfig = formatterConfig;
LaunchInnerCallback = onAfterInitialization;
if (CompleteWriterOnLaunchInner)
PostedMessages.Writer.Complete();
onAfterInitialization(true);
}
protected override async Task ConsumeAndFormatMessagesBackgroundTask(CancellationToken cancellationToken)
{
ConsumeAndFormatMessagesCalled = true;
ConsumedToken = cancellationToken;
await foreach (var msg in PostedMessages.Reader.ReadAllAsync(cancellationToken))
{
ConsumedMessages.Add(msg);
}
}
public void SetClosed(bool value)
{
typeof(FormatterBase).GetField("Closed", System.Reflection.BindingFlags.Instance | System.Reflection.BindingFlags.NonPublic)!.SetValue(this, value);
}
}
private readonly Mock<IFormattersConfigurationProvider> _configMock = new();
private readonly Mock<IFormatterLog> _loggerMock = new();
private readonly Mock<ICucumberMessageBroker> _brokerMock = new();
private readonly TestFormatter _sut;
public FormatterBaseTests()
{
_sut = new TestFormatter(_configMock.Object, _loggerMock.Object, "testPlugin");
}
[Fact]
public void LaunchFormatter_Disabled_ReportsInitializedFalse()
{
_configMock.Setup(c => c.Enabled).Returns(false);
_sut.LaunchFormatter(_brokerMock.Object);
_loggerMock.Verify(l => l.WriteMessage(It.Is<string>(s => s.Contains("disabled via configuration"))), Times.Once);
_brokerMock.Verify(b => b.FormatterInitialized(_sut, false), Times.Once);
}
[Fact]
public void LaunchFormatter_Enabled_Calls_LaunchInner_And_StartsTask()
{
_configMock.Setup(c => c.Enabled).Returns(true);
_configMock.Setup(c => c.GetFormatterConfigurationByName("testPlugin")).Returns(new Dictionary<string, object>());
_sut.LaunchFormatter(_brokerMock.Object);
_sut.LaunchInnerCalled.Should().BeTrue();
_sut.LaunchInnerConfig.Should().NotBeNull();
_sut.LaunchInnerCallback.Should().NotBeNull();
}
[Fact]
public async Task PublishAsync_Writes_Message_And_Closes_On_TestRunFinished()
{
_configMock.Setup(c => c.Enabled).Returns(true);
_configMock.Setup(c => c.GetFormatterConfigurationByName("testPlugin")).Returns(new Dictionary<string, object>());
_sut.LaunchFormatter(_brokerMock.Object);
var msg = Envelope.Create(new TestRunFinished("", false, new Timestamp(0, 0), null, ""));
await _sut.PublishAsync(msg);
_sut.ConsumedMessages.Should().Contain(msg);
}
[Fact]
public async Task PublishAsync_Does_Not_Write_When_Closed()
{
_sut.SetClosed(true);
var msg = Envelope.Create(new TestRunStarted(new Timestamp(0, 0), ""));
await _sut.PublishAsync(msg);
_loggerMock.Verify(l => l.WriteMessage(It.Is<string>(s => s.Contains("formatter is closed"))), Times.Once);
}
[Fact]
public async Task CloseAsync_Throws_If_Already_Closed()
{
_configMock.Setup(c => c.Enabled).Returns(true);
_configMock.Setup(c => c.GetFormatterConfigurationByName("testPlugin")).Returns(new Dictionary<string, object>());
_sut.LaunchFormatter(_brokerMock.Object);
await _sut.PublishAsync(Envelope.Create(new TestRunStarted(new Timestamp(0, 0), "")));
await _sut.CloseAsync();
await Assert.ThrowsAsync<InvalidOperationException>(async () => await _sut.CloseAsync());
}
[Fact]
public void Dispose_Waits_For_FormatterTask_And_DumpsMessages()
{
_configMock.Setup(c => c.Enabled).Returns(true);
_configMock.Setup(c => c.GetFormatterConfigurationByName("testPlugin")).Returns(new Dictionary<string, object>());
_sut.LaunchFormatter(_brokerMock.Object);
_sut.Dispose();
_loggerMock.Verify(l => l.DumpMessages(), Times.Once);
}
[Fact]
public void LaunchFormatter_NoConfigEntry_ReportsInitializedFalse()
{
_configMock.Setup(c => c.Enabled).Returns(true);
_configMock.Setup(c => c.GetFormatterConfigurationByName("testPlugin")).Returns((IDictionary<string, object>)null!);
_sut.LaunchFormatter(_brokerMock.Object);
_loggerMock.Verify(l => l.WriteMessage(It.Is<string>(s => s.Contains("disabled via configuration"))), Times.Once);
_brokerMock.Verify(b => b.FormatterInitialized(_sut, false), Times.Once);
}
[Fact]
public void LaunchFormatter_EmptyConfigEntry_ReportsInitializedTrue()
{
_configMock.Setup(c => c.Enabled).Returns(true);
_configMock.Setup(c => c.GetFormatterConfigurationByName("testPlugin")).Returns(new Dictionary<string, object>());
_sut.LaunchFormatter(_brokerMock.Object);
_sut.LaunchInnerCalled.Should().BeTrue();
_sut.LaunchInnerConfig.Should().NotBeNull();
_sut.LaunchInnerConfig.Should().BeEmpty();
_sut.LaunchInnerCallback.Should().NotBeNull();
_brokerMock.Verify(b => b.FormatterInitialized(_sut, true), Times.Once);
}
}
